why you must not vote through Internet from home?

First of all because the problems concerned with the security of the net are increasing considerably. While at a polling station there is a visual and physical "identification", via Internet there can only be an electronic "identification" and it's therefore possible that someone else simulates to be you and votes in your stead. Moreover in areas with a large presence of a strong criminal underworld, (where there is none?) , it'possible that somebody comes to your house and makes you vote as he likes, by the use of threats. Without having to enter your house somebody could be content of a visual recorded evidence of your vote ( who hasn't a video-recorder nowadays? ). The presence of criminal underworld in the social structure is a further reason, and not the least one, why to go along with the paper system over which a larger democratic control is possible.
